diff --git a/zh-cn/application-dev/reference/apis/js-apis-workSchedulerExtension.md b/zh-cn/application-dev/reference/apis/js-apis-WorkSchedulerExtensionAbility.md similarity index 56% rename from zh-cn/application-dev/reference/apis/js-apis-workSchedulerExtension.md rename to zh-cn/application-dev/reference/apis/js-apis-WorkSchedulerExtensionAbility.md index 335929c07c3daaf45ebd61f1ca80e6a52b15ca4d..99af6cd9045c0cf8cc220d30cd230a24579e97a4 100644 --- a/zh-cn/application-dev/reference/apis/js-apis-workSchedulerExtension.md +++ b/zh-cn/application-dev/reference/apis/js-apis-WorkSchedulerExtensionAbility.md @@ -7,10 +7,10 @@ ## 导入模块 ``` -import workSchedulerExtension from '@ohos.WorkSchedulerExtension' +import WorkSchedulerExtensionAbility from '@ohos.WorkSchedulerExtensionAbility' ``` -## WorkSchedulerExtension.onWorkStart +## WorkSchedulerExtensionAbility.onWorkStart - **系统能力**: SystemCapability.ResourceSchedule.WorkScheduler @@ -23,14 +23,14 @@ onWorkStart(workInfo: WorkInfo); - **示例**: ``` - export default class MyWorkSchedulerExtension extends WorkSchedulerExtension { + export default class MyWorkSchedulerExtensionAbility extends WorkSchedulerExtensionAbility { onWorkStart(workInfo) { - console.log('MyWorkSchedulerExtension onWorkStart' + JSON.stringify(workInfo)); + console.log('MyWorkSchedulerExtensionAbility onWorkStart' + JSON.stringify(workInfo)); } } ``` -## WorkSchedulerExtension.onWorkStop +## WorkSchedulerExtensionAbility.onWorkStop - **系统能力**: SystemCapability.ResourceSchedule.WorkScheduler @@ -43,9 +43,9 @@ onWorkStop(workInfo: WorkInfo); - **示例**: ``` - export default class MyWorkSchedulerExtension extends WorkSchedulerExtension { + export default class MyWorkSchedulerExtensionAbility extends WorkSchedulerExtensionAbility { onWorkStop(workInfo) { - console.log('MyWorkSchedulerExtension onWorkStop' + JSON.stringify(workInfo)); + console.log('MyWorkSchedulerExtensionAbility onWorkStop' + JSON.stringify(workInfo)); } } ``` \ No newline at end of file diff --git a/zh-cn/application-dev/work-scheduler/work-scheduler-dev-guide.md b/zh-cn/application-dev/work-scheduler/work-scheduler-dev-guide.md index d61b52a6d54568481e7730f2f12618e9d573bbd6..4d72584bf0f4e08d169877942f8c5a1ef7ba386f 100644 --- a/zh-cn/application-dev/work-scheduler/work-scheduler-dev-guide.md +++ b/zh-cn/application-dev/work-scheduler/work-scheduler-dev-guide.md @@ -13,7 +13,7 @@ import workScheduler from '@ohos.workScheduler'; 回调相关接口包导入: ```js -import WorkSchedulerExtension from '@ohos.WorkSchedulerExtension'; +import WorkSchedulerExtensionAbility from '@ohos.WorkSchedulerExtensionAbility'; ``` ### 延迟任务调度 @@ -60,14 +60,14 @@ function onWorkStop(work: WorkInfo): void; | 延迟调度任务结束回调 **开发对应的Extension** - import WorkSchedulerExtension from '@ohos.WorkSchedulerExtension'; + import WorkSchedulerExtensionAbility from '@ohos.WorkSchedulerExtensionAbility'; - export default class MyWorkSchedulerExtension extends WorkSchedulerExtension { + export default class MyWorkSchedulerExtensionAbility extends WorkSchedulerExtensionAbility { onWorkStart(workInfo) { - console.log('MyWorkSchedulerExtension onWorkStart' + JSON.stringify(workInfo)); + console.log('MyWorkSchedulerExtensionAbility onWorkStart' + JSON.stringify(workInfo)); } onWorkStop(workInfo) { - console.log('MyWorkSchedulerExtension onWorkStop' + JSON.stringify(workInfo)); + console.log('MyWorkSchedulerExtensionAbility onWorkStop' + JSON.stringify(workInfo)); } }